Regulation and Oversight:

So that you can ensure the protection and well being of young ones in 24-hour daycare centers, regulation and supervision are crucial. State and local governing bodies put criteria for certification and accreditation of daycare centers, including those that function twenty-four hours a day. These requirements cover an array of areas, including staff-to-child ratios, safe practices requirements, and staff instruction and skills.

Along with government laws, numerous 24-hour daycare centers choose to seek certification from national companies for instance the nationwide Association for the knowledge of Young Children (NAEYC) and/or National Association for Family childcare (NAFCC). Accreditation demonstrates dedication to top-notch attention and may assist parents feel confident inside their selection of childcare supplier.
